Reared broodstock of Penaeus monodon Auteur(s) : AQUACOP Éditeur(s) : Proceeding of symposium on Coastal Aquaculture, Cochin (India) Résumé : Since 1975, maturation and spawning in captivity of Penaeus monodon has been achieved in the 'Centre Océanologique du Pacifique', a CNEXO Centre in Tahiti. The five first animals have been imported from Fiji Islands and in May 1979, four generations-have been obtained. Under the rearing conditions followed at the Centre, reproduction is achieved all throughout the year. Maturation is induced by unilateral eyestalk ablation on pond reared animals maintained in tanks on adequate food. Results concern mating behaviour, ovarian development, number of spawnings per female and egg viability. The rearing and the maintenance conditions of the captive broodstocks are particularly important to obtain reliable results necessary to sustain commercial hatcheries. Mass production of postlarvae is routinely achieved. Maturation and spawning in captivity of penaeid shrimps Auteur(s) : Aquacop, Aquacop Éditeur(s) : Proceedings of the 6 th Annual Meeting of World Mariculture Society Résumé : As no indigenous species of commercial penaeid shrimp live in the waters of French Po1ynesia, the pre1iminary step in deve10ping shrimp aquaculture was to obtain maturation and spawning in captivity. Five species have been investigated. Wi1d-caught juveni1es from the New Ca1edonia 1agoon (f. merguiensis, f. semisulcatus, ~. ensis) and post1arvae from the Ga1veston NMFS 1aboratory (P. aztecus) and Fujinaga Institute (f. japonicus) have been used to-obtain adu1t stock. Shrimps are reared in circu1ar tanks of 12 m3 with a continuous water circulation through a coral sand bed. Rate of exchange is from 1 to 3 times a day. Throughout the year water temperature is between 25 and 29 C, sa1inity around 34.5 ppt, and pH 8.2. Solar energy is reduced by shade covers. Artificial pellets of different composition are given as food. In these conditions we have obtained: 1) about 1,000 spawnings and two generations in captivity from September 1973 to September 1974 with f. merguiensis; 2) spawnings of ~. ensis in 1973; 3) four spawnings of f. japonicus in September 1974; 4) about 20 spawnings of P. aztecus, but only aftcr removing one eyestalk; 5) maturation signs in P. semizulcatus but no spawning. Experiments on larval rearing and growth of these species are in progress. Reproduction in captivity and growth of Penaeus monodon, Fabricius in Polynesia Auteur(s) : Aquacop, Aquacop Éditeur(s) : 8 th Workshop of World Mariculture Society, Costa Rica, 10-13 janvier 1977 Résumé : To develop shrimp fanning in French Polynesia where no indigenous commercial species of penaeid prawn exists, the first step is to select the right species according to the following criteria: maturation and spawning in captivity, mass production of post-larvae, fast growth at semi-intensive density, acceptability of artificial diet, disease resistance and hardiness. This paper presents the results on P. monodon, Fabricius, the largest Indo-Pacific species. Experiments have been conducted in the "Centre Océanologique du Pacifique" in Tahiti Island where the environmental conditions are water temperature range 25-29 C, salinity 35 ppt, pH 8.2. Penaeid reared brood stock : closing the cycle Auteur(s) : AQUACOP Éditeur(s) : 10 th Meeting of the World Mariculture Society. Honolulu, January 1979 Résumé : Three shrimp species, Penaeus monodon, P. stylirostris (Panama and Mexican strains) and P. vannamei have matured and spawned in captivity at the Centre Océanologique du Pacifique (COP) laboratory. The shrimp, originally stocked as juveniles or postlarvae, were reared to adult size in tanks and ponds and have completed the cycle: F3 generation for P. monodon, F2 for P. stylirostris (Panama strain) and P. vannamei and F1 for P. stylirostris (Mexican strain). Maturation occurs naturally under our rearing conditions or is induced by unilateral eyestalk ablation. Details are given on mating behavior, ovarian development, number of spawnings, egg viability and maintenance of captive brood stock. Partial results so far obtained for P. monodon and P. stylirostris clearly show a reared brood stock could sustain a commercial hatchery. Recent innovations in cultivation of molluscs in french Polynesia Auteur(s) : AQUACOP Éditeur(s) : 1st International Biennal Conference on Warm Water Aquaculture - Crustacea 02/9-11/83 Brigham Young University. Hawai Résumé : Until recently, mollusc production in French Polynesia was only based upon fishing, for local consumption of edible bivalves mainly the oyster Saccostrea cucullata and for the exportation of pearl-oyster shells. As a consequence of parasitism problems on local oysters, a mollusc program was initiated by developping hatchery technics on introduced species of edible bivalves, Saccostrea echinata and Perna viridis, and cultivation methods in specialyy fitted up areas. Concerning pearl oyster Pinctada margaritifera the traditional shell production activity was recently reorganized to produce black culture pearls, inducing an increased demand of young implantable pearl-oysters. Hatchery spat production proved to be unsuccessful, and technics of collection and cultivation in lagoons were set up to supply the pearl oyster farming industry, and face the depletion natural stock. Compte-rendu d'expérimentation : comparaison entre l'Acal et le Frippak utilisés en nurserie de Penaeus vannamei Auteur(s) : Bador, Régis Boisson, Gilles Delafosse, Jean-charles Le Moullac, Gilles AQUACOP Résumé : Deux séries d'expérimentation ont été menées pour tester les performances en nurserie des deux microparticules mises au point dans le groupe IFREMER/FA/SANOFI : l'ACAL et le FRIPPAK FLAKES. Alors qu'en survie et en croissance en taille (longueur totale) aucune différence n'est mise en évidence, l'ACAL permet de produire des prégrossies de poids sec supérieur et nettement plus résistantes aux chocs de salinité que le FRIPPAK. The evolution of the clear water hatchery system for Macrobrachium rosenbergii in the French West Indies from 1979 to 1984 Auteur(s) : Lacroix, Denis Robin, Thierry Sica Aquacole De Martinique, Aquacop, Éditeur(s) : Proceedings of 16th annual meeting of the World Mariculture Society; Orlando, Fla, USA. 13-17 Jan. 1985 Résumé : The clearwater larval rearing method for Macrobrachium rosenbergii was perfected in the french research center of Tahiti in 1977 nad carried on to improve the technique especially on recirculating system. This aquaculture is launched in Martinique by the regional council in 1976. A first "green water" hatchery is built and provides juveniles to the first ponds.
